Dos familias asisten a un sitio de comidas rápidas de la ciudad, una de ellas pide 4 perros calientes y 3 hamburguesas y pagan 43000 pesos, la otra familia, piden 5 perros calientes y 1 hamburguesa y pagan 34500 pesos, se desea saber ¿cuál es el valor de cada perro y de cada hamburguesa?.
Answer:
Cada perro caliente cuesta 5,500 pesos y cada hamburguesa cuesta 7,000 pesos.
Step-by-step explanation:
Sea x el precio de los perros calientes y y el precio de las hamburguesas.
Escribiendo los datos de la primera familia en forma de ecuación tenemos:
[tex]4x+3y=43,000[/tex] (4 perros calientes y 3 hamburguesas cuestan 43,000 pesos)
Escribiendo los datos de la segunda familia:
[tex]5x+y=34500[/tex] (5 perros calientes y 1 hamburguesa cuestan 34,500 pesos)
Vamos a resolver este sistema de ecuaciones por el método de suma y resta:
[tex]4x+3y=43,000\\5x+y= 34,500[/tex]
Multiplicando la segunda ecuación por -3 y sumando ambas tenemos:
[tex]4x+3y=43,000\\-15x-3y= -103,500\\\\-11x=-60,500\\x=-60,500/-11\\x= 5,500[/tex]
Por lo tanto, un perro caliente cuesta 5,500 pesos.
Ahora sustituimos este valor en nuestra segunda ecuación para encontrar el precio de las hamburguesas:
[tex]5x+y=34500\\5(5,500)+y=34,500\\27,500 +y=34,500\\y=34,500-27,500\\y=7,000[/tex]
Por lo tanto, las hamburguesas cuestan 7,000 pesos cada una

A medical researcher is studying the effects of a drug on blood pressure. Subjects in the study have their blood pressure taken at the beginning of the study. After being on the medication for 4 weeks, their blood pressure is taken again. The change in blood pressure is recorded and used in doing the hypothesis test. Change: Final Blood Pressure - Initial Blood Pressure The researcher wants to know if there is evidence that the drug increases blood pressure. At the end of 4 weeks, 32 subjects in the study had an average change in blood pressure of 2.5 with a standard deviation of 4.8. Find the p -value for the hypothesis test.
Answer:
The p -value for the hypothesis test is 0.003.
Step-by-step explanation:
In this case, a paired t-test would be used to determine whether the drug increases blood pressure.
The hypothesis can be defined as follows:
H₀: The drug has no effect on blood pressure, i.e. d = 0.
Hₐ: The drug increases blood pressure, i.e. d > 0.
The information provided is:
[tex]n=32\\\bar d=2.5\\S_{d}=4.8[/tex]
The test statistic is:
[tex]t=\frac{\bar d}{S_{d}/\sqrt{n}}[/tex]
[tex]=\frac{2.5}{4.8/\sqrt{32}}\\\\=2.9463\\\\\approx 2.95[/tex]
The degrees of freedom of the test is:
[tex]df=n-1=32-1=31[/tex]
The p-value of the test is:
[tex]p-value=P(t_{31}>2.95)=0.003[/tex]
*Use a t-table.
Thus, the p -value for the hypothesis test is 0.003.

which equation has roots of 3plus or minus sqare rt 2?
Answer:
Option D is correct.
The equation with roots 3 plus or minus square root 2 is x² - 6x + 7
Step-by-step explanation:
The roots of the unknown equation are
3 ± √2, that is, (3 + √2) and (3 - √2)
The equation can then be reconstructed by writing these roots as the solutions of the quadratic equation
x = (3 + √2) or x = (3 - √2)
The equation is this
[x - (3 + √2)] × [x - (3 - √2)]
(x - 3 - √2) × (x - 3 + √2)
x(x - 3 + √2) - 3(x - 3 + √2) - √2(x - 3 + √2)
= x² - 3x + x√2 - 3x + 9 - 3√2 - x√2 + 3√2 - 2
Collecting like terms
= x² - 3x - 3x + x√2 - x√2 - 3√2 + 3√2 + 9 - 2
= x² - 6x + 7

Two pathways meet at 30° to each other. One pathway has lighting and the other does not.
The distance between successive lights on the lighted pathway is 5 metres. Each light has a
range of effective illumination of 6 metres.
What length of the pathway without lights is illuminated by the pathway with lights?
Answer:
12 meters
Step-by-step explanation:
Draw a picture of the two pathways 30° apart. Add a circle representing the illumination of the light on one of the pathways. Draw a line from the center of the circle to the last point where it intersects the pathway without lights.
This forms a triangle. One leg is x, the length of the pathway without lights. Another leg is 5n, where n is an integer. This represents how far the light is from where the pathways meet. The third and final leg is 6, the radius of the illumination.
Use law of cosine to solve:
6² = x² + (5n)² − 2x(5n) cos 30°
36 = x² + 25n² − 5√3 xn
0 = x² − 5√3 xn + 25n² − 36
In order to have a solution, the discriminant must be greater than or equal to 0.
b² − 4ac ≥ 0
(-5√3 n)² − 4(1)(25n² − 36) ≥ 0
75n² − 100n² + 144 ≥ 0
144 − 25n² ≥ 0
144 ≥ 25n²
144/25 ≥ n²
12/5 ≥ n
So n must be an integer less than 12/5, or 2.4. Therefore, the largest value of n is 2. Substituting:
0 = x² − 5√3 x(2) + 25(2)² − 36
0 = x² − 10√3 x + 64
Solve with quadratic formula:
x = [ 10√3 ± √(300 − 4(1)(64)) ] / 2(1)
x = (10√3 ± √44) / 2
x = 5√3 ± √11
x ≈ 5.34 or 11.98
We want the larger value of x. So approximately 12 meters of the pathway without lights is illuminated.

New packaging for fruit snacks contains 10% less weight than the original packaging. If the new package costs 15% more than the original package, by what fraction did the unit price increase? Express your answer as a common fraction.
Answer:
5/18
Step-by-step explanation:
Let's say the original packaging was 1 lb of packaging for $1.
The cost was $1/lb.
Then the weight went down by 10% and the price went up by 15%.
Now 0.9 lb of packaging cost $1.15.
The new unit cost is $1.15/(0.9 lb)
The difference is
$1.15/(0.9 lb) - $1/lb =
= $1.15/(0.9 lb) - $0.9/(0.9 lb)
= $0.25/(0.9 lb)
=$25/(90 lb) = $5/(18 lb)
The price went up by 5/18.
